Cocaine worth over 400 thousand leva seized near Simitli

Photo: Facebook/gdbop.bg

A specialized police operation by the Directorate of the Bulgarian Anti-Drug and Drug Enforcement Administration (GDBOP) uncovered an organized crime group operating in the Blagoevgrad region, related to the distribution of narcotics. 

5 kg of cocaine worth over 400 thousand leva were seized, 7 people were charged, 5 of them were detained for 72 hours, BGNES reported. 

One of the detainees is Ognyan Atanasov, called by journalists "the Bulgarian Escobar". In 2019, Atanasov received a 15-year sentence from the Court of Appeal in Thessaloniki for importing, trafficking and selling drugs in Greece. He was transferred to serve his sentence in Bulgaria. At the end of 2022, he was pardoned and released from prison, BNT reports.
